  • Abstract
    Y Fe0.5Cr0.5O3 ceramics have been synthesized by a conventional solid-state reaction. Powder X-ray diffraction shows that this compound possesses an orthorhombic structure with Pnma space group. It exhibits a high magnetic transition temperature at around 250 K with weak ferromagnetic behavior below this temperature. A dielectric relaxation following the Arrhenius law found in the Y Fe0.5Cr0.5O3 compound can be attributed to the charge carrier hopping conduction.
